About Xiumei Zheng

Xiumei Zheng is a scholar working on General Engineering, Molecular Medicine and Oncology, having authored 25 papers that have together received 533 indexed citations. Recurring topics across this work include Cancer Cells and Metastasis (4 papers), DNA Repair Mechanisms (2 papers) and Multiple Sclerosis Research Studies (2 papers). The work is most often cited by research in Molecular Medicine (84 citations), Cancer Research (167 citations) and Oncology (171 citations). Xiumei Zheng has collaborated with scholars based in China, Hong Kong and Germany. Frequent co-authors include Dan Feng, Peiyang Li, Jun Zou, Shanshan Zhang, Hong Ma, Lei Zhao, Shao‐Yi Huang, Xiaomeng Dai, Dejun Zhang and Haiyan Mai. Their work appears in journals such as SHILAP Revista de lepidopterología, Analytical Chemistry and Journal of Agricultural and Food Chemistry.
